§ 2-383. Powers of the board.  


Latest version.
  • The board shall have the power to:

    (1)

    Adopt rules for the conduct of its hearings.

    (2)

    Subpoena alleged violators and witnesses to its hearings. Police department of the city or the sheriff of Alachua County may serve subpoenas.

    (3)

    Subpoena evidence to its hearings.

    (4)

    Take testimony under oath.

    (5)

    Issue orders having the force of law to command whatever steps are necessary to bring a violation into compliance.

(Code 1960, § 29B-8; Ord. No. 3566, § 3, 9-18-89; Ord. No. 020196, § 7, 9-9-02)
